I am back after a month of not doing anything lego related, this time i am back with the town theme and more specific Modular buildings, from what i have seen online we havent had a bakery designed for modular buildings so i thought i would design one and submit it to lego ideas, this design borrows a lot from my Artists Home project, mostly the style which is loosely based on 15th century Italy
